If you have just arrived in Thailand, learn more about the culture by taking a cooking course. Even if you don’t know your way around a wok, by the end of the day you’ll be turning out a mean dish of Tom Yam Goong (spicy shrimp soup).
Thai cooking classes are available in most hotels in Bangkok, but one of the best and most relaxing places to try out your culinary skills is in the northern city of Chiang Mai. Almost every guesthouse offers cooking classes that cost between $20 and $70 depending on the length of the course, which can range from one to five days. And the best part is you get to eat everything you make! |

After all that shopping, treat yourself to a foot or full-body massage, or get primped and pampered from head to toe. There are a number of high-end and budget beauty salons that offer haircuts, treatments, highlighting and hair colouring. (A little hint: Most street-side salons offer manicures and pedicures for as little as $2.)
For more regal indulgences, many fine hotels house spas that offer treatments such as aromatherapy massage to being ensconced in a full-bodied orange-chocolate wrap and soothing papaya scrub facials. Be careful not to go on an empty stomach, or you might be tempted to sample the products!

If you have just moved to Bangkok and are interested in connecting with other like-minded ladies, there are a number of social groups that hold events or more casual get-togethers for women only. A recent addition to the social networking scene is BNOW, a weekly e-mail group that answers questions about living in Bangkok. The group also hosts speed dating events -- a definite must for all the single ladies out there. You can find them at www.geocities.com/bnow_th/BNOW.html or e-mail the group at BNOW@inet.co.th.
Another social group that holds informal get-togethers at bars or pubs in the city is SWIB (Social Women In Bangkok). Contact them at swib@pacific.net.th
For the literary-minded lady, check out the Bangkok Women's Writers Group. It’s a social writing group for women interested in poetry, fiction, non-fiction, essays etc. The group holds weekly writing sessions and occasional afternoon teas at the Oriental Hotel. Contact Lois Ann Haley-Dort at bkk_writers@yahoo.com (02-653-8753) or visit www.bwwg.net.
